When a horrific natural disaster causes the collapse of civilisation and strands Cody Ryan deep inside the Arctic Circle, he is forced to embark upon an impossible journey. Thousands of miles from home in a brutal new world where only the strongest will survive, Cody and his companions must conquer seemingly insurmountable odds in a search for their loved ones, the limits of their own humanity and the rumoured last refuge of mankind… Eden.COPYRIGHT: DEAN CRAWFORD 2013

Deep in the mountain wilderness of Missouri, a lone hiker in the forests witnesses a brilliant pulse of light that temporarily blinds her as she returns to her remote hometown of Clearwater. Upon recovering her vision the following morning, she is shocked to find that every single one of the town’s three hundred inhabitants have vanished. Worse, Clearwater looks as though nobody has set foot in it for more than half a century… The Defense Intelligence Agency, struggling to root out the identities of the members of “Majestic Twelve”, a powerful cabal suspected of discreetly directing world affairs for profit, dispatches Ethan Warner and Nicola Lopez to Clearwater in an effort to discover what happened to the population and why the news media hasn’t covered the remarkable vanishing. They find a town deserted for decades and yet the food in chillers remains fresh, evidence of recent habitation concealed beneath the grime and filth of ages. Stumbling upon the lone survivor, suddenly they are plunged into a conspiracy that could change the world forever. From the forests of Missouri to the scorching deserts of Nigeria, from Saudi Arabia to the high-tech laboratories of a massive nuclear facility in France, they face a whirlwind of corporate espionage while being pursued by hitmen charged with ensuring nobody ever learns of mass disappearances that have occurred in remote towns around the world for decades…

AGGRESSOR   The Atlantia is all that remains of humanity: a former fleet frigate turned prison-ship now hunted by a terrifying force and crewed by an alliance of murderous convicts, exhausted soldiers and terrified civilians determined to confront the technological horror that has consumed mankind. Pursuing the infamous pirate Taron Forge, the Atlantia encounters the aged wreck of a legendary vessel, Endeavour, the first human ship ever to leave the Core Systems to explore the cosmos. Missing for almost a century,  Atlantia’s Marines board the ship in the hope of finding other survivors. But what they find aboard Endeavour is a legacy of humanity’s hopes and dreams twisted into a nightmare, and a future held in the hands of their greatest enemy: The Word and its Legion. As the crew comes to terms with their discoveries, so Evelyn is forced to confront her own personal demons as the truth behind her immunity to the Legion’s Infectors is finally revealed, and the wider galaxy’s plans for humanity laid bare.   Endeavour is the fourth volume of the Atlantia series from internationally best-selling author Dean Crawford, is DRM free and is 103,000 words in length.

Twenty years after renowned palaeontologist Doctor Aubrey Channing goes missing after making a spectacular discovery in the Badlands of Montana, Ethan Warner and Nicola Lopez of the Defense Intelligence Agency’s ARIES program are despatched to investigate bizarre links between the scientist’s disappearance and a legendary UFO encounter witnessed by hundreds in the Brazilian town of Varginha. But they are not alone in their quest. Pursued by the cabal of Majestic Twelve, who have chosen to eliminate their foes once and for all, and with Aaron Mitchell’s shadowy assassin gunning for revenge against all who have crossed him, suddenly everybody is on the hunt for Channing. As they close in on the mystery so Ethan and Nicola realize that the end has begun, for the Sixth Extinction is already upon us and only one man possesses the key to its cure. From the freezing glaciers of Norway’s Doomsday Vault to the remote jungles of Madagascar, the sweltering heat of Brazil’s rainforests and a mysterious island in the Atlantic Ocean, Ethan and Nicola must race against time to defeat not only their foes but their allies too. For in the race for survival, it’s every man for himself… ABOUT THE AUTHOR Dean Crawford began writing after his dream of becoming a fighter pilot in the Royal Air Force was curtailed when he failed their stringent sight tests. His Ethan Warner series of high-concept novels have regularly featured on the Sunday Times paperback bestseller list and have sold all over the world. A full-time author, he lives with his partner and daughter in Surrey. **
